# Context: the Harrowgate stale-cache incident.
# The session cache served entries long past their intended lifetime because
# the TTL and the refresh interval were defined in two different modules and
# drifted apart over several releases. We consolidated every timing value
# here so they are reviewed together. Do not split them up again.
# The agreed values follow.

tuning table, faduf-baduf:
PRIORITIES = {
    "ulavan": 191,
    "silys": 750,
    "goriel": 238,
    "kelmir": 66,
    "wendor": 432,
}

## Break-Glass Access: Mergewell Dedup Pipeline

Mergewell deduplicates customer records nightly. Reviewers approving changes to the matching rules occasionally need break-glass access to the golden-record vault to compare live merge outcomes against fixtures. Access is logged and expires after one hour. Open the vault from the Mergewell admin console; it will prompt for the recovery passphrase below.

vault phrase of kawep-tahog = ulaix-briath

## Migration Step 4: Enabling Offline Mode

Before merging, verify that TerraCount's sync daemon is disabled in offline builds; the field-survey client must queue observations locally in the Harkwell store and replay them only after connectivity checks pass twice consecutively. Reviewers should confirm the queue flush interval matches the value agreed with the Pellbridge ops group, since a shorter interval drains batteries on older handhelds. Once you have validated the schema bump, apply the settings below exactly as written.

deployment values, tagug-tagaf:
[zorix]
team = druix
access_code = ac_42e3e2
host = zorix.qirvancorp.test
port = 6379
owner = beldor.gordor
peer = kelath.zemvarcorp.test

## Who to ping about GiftNote

Welcome aboard! GiftNote is our donation-receipt mailer for the Larchfield Fund. Template tweaks go to the comms folks; delivery failures and bounce weirdness go to the platform crew. Don't push template changes on Fridays — receipts batch over the weekend. For anything GiftNote-related, start with the address below.

billing contact of kaweg-tajeg = drudor.lamion.oliath@torvalabs.test